Summary
A 51-year-old man, Ryo Kawaguchi, was arrested in Nagoya’s Chikusa Ward on September 2, 2025, for a hit-and-run incident that occurred over a year ago. On August 19, 2024, Kawaguchi struck a 47-year-old cyclist at a crosswalk in Minami Ward while driving a compact car and fled the scene. The cyclist sustained a spinal injury. Police identified Kawaguchi as the suspect through dashcam and security camera footage and conducted a year-long investigation. Despite his arrest, Kawaguchi has chosen to remain silent during questioning.
